The Vilalara Grand Hotel Algarve was awarded Best Beach Hotel in the 21st edition of the Portugal Travel Awards by Publituris, an award that recognizes reference units, companies and projects in national tourism.

The distinction was announced during the ceremony held at the Hilton Vilamoura Resort & Spa, in the Algarve. The winners were determined through voting by the Portugal Travel Awards jury, Publituris subscribers and subscribers to the publication’s daily newsletter.

The award comes in the year in which Vilalara marks its 60th anniversary, reinforcing the recognition of an identity built over six decades, between the sea, the landscape, hospitality and successive generations of guests.

Founded in the second half of the 1960s by George Ansley, on the cliffs of Porches, in the municipality of Lagoa, the resort established itself through the connection between architecture, nature, well-being and discreet service, maintaining a close relationship with those who work at the unit and with those who choose it as a destination.

Throughout 2026, the hotel has marked its 60th anniversary with a commemorative program dedicated to the people, places and traditions that contributed to shaping the identity of the resort and the Algarve.

Among the initiatives already carried out are the “60 Years on the Cliffs” dinner, at the Gaivotas restaurant, which revisited the hotel’s origins through a gastronomic trajectory inspired by the 60s, and a special edition of the Vilalara Chronicle Dinners, which brought together the Raízes restaurant and the historic Adega Vila Lisa, in a celebration of Algarve identity and gastronomy.

The commemorative program continues throughout the year, with new initiatives planned as part of the 60th anniversary celebrations.

Hotel occupies 11 hectares on the cliffs of Porches

Located on the cliffs of Porches, Vilalara Grand Hotel Algarve occupies 11 hectares of gardens, with more than 300 species of fauna and flora, and has direct access to Praia das Gaivotas.

A member of the Forbes Travel Guide, the resort currently has 131 accommodation units and six food spaces, including the Coral restaurant, recommended by the Michelin Guide Portugal 2026, and the Raízes restaurant, based on the garden-to-table concept.

The offer also includes a concession and beach bar, a tennis and padel club with a resident teacher, in partnership with Lux Tennis, and a pioneering wellness center in thalassotherapy in Portugal.

Currently dedicated exclusively to thalassotherapy, the spa offers revitalization and well-being programs, two indoor medicinal pools and treatments with salt water extracted directly from the sea, also used in the resort’s five outdoor pools.
